Abstract

The author practices his itinerant spirituality of Deleuze with an experimental reading of his work into spiritual contexts, attempting to reframe his plane of immanence as a version of the Imaginal plane, a plane of luminance. He looks at Deleuze's construction of the plane of immanence in Cinema 1, integrating Bergson and Einstein's concept of a plane composed of a universe of light, and performs his own thought-experiment. He cites that the plane of luminance he constructed provides a tool for thought into the spiritual meaning of Deleuze's writings.
